1. Cedar Pride Wreck
Cedar Pride Wreck is one of the top and most popular spots in Aqaba for divers. The area is home to an artificial reef that teems with tons of marine life. It’s one of the best spots for thrill-seeking divers, as the amazing environment creates an experience that one can remember for a long time.

3. First Bay
First Bay is yet another spot that both snorkelers and divers should try. It’s located south of the main city of Aqaba, and offers tons of entertainment and water sports opportunities for adventure-seekers.

1. Japanese Garden
Aqaba’s top snorkelling spot belongs to a site called Japanese Garden, one of the most beautiful and serene spots you can visit. It’s home to a vast variety of marine life such as butterfly fishes, and much more. Snorkeling and going deep in the ocean while being accompanied by amazing underwater scenery is one of the top experiences you can have on this site.

2. South Beach
The mesmerising South Beach of Aqaba is another site to try snorkelling in. It’s one of the spots that is recommended for novices to hone their snorkelling skills. It’s easily accessible and is known for being a starting point for new snorkelers as well as being one of the most beautiful places to visit in Aqaba.
